When I went to my 10 week appointment they could not hear the baby's heartbeat by Doppler. However, my doctor had an old ultrasound in the exam room and just quickly scanned my belly and we got to see the hearbeat again. |

I am 9 weeks and 1 day, due October 30th. First one! I heard the heart beat for the first time on Tuesday, but they told me that I am lucky that I am small because if I was any bigger, they probably wouldn't be able to find it so soon. They said that if you have any excess fat on your belly, it can make it harder to find the heartbeat. Also, I think it depends on how the baby is positioned. I wouldn't worry, it they think there is a problem, they will probably schedule an ultra sound. Good luck! |
